Details


The venue Jed and Christa chose for their wedding, was a little church nestled in the beautiful countryside of the Skagit Valley in NW Washington, and the reception was held at the Cross Country Cowboy Church barn, also located in the beautiful Skagit Valley. Between these two lovely PNW locations, the couple selected the perfect backdrops to reflect their lifestyle and love for the country life. A rustic, wooden arch, decorated with flowers and lace, graced the center stage of the church, with a western theme of lovely, lit, lanterns, flowers, wood, and brushed aluminum accents as details for both the church and the reception barn. Wooden ladders hosted snapshots of the couple, along with mason jar candles, and flowers at the top of each ladder. A second rustic, wooden, arch, decorated with fabric and flowers, stood behind the cake table.
